Human spinal motor neurons derived from iPSC line WC-30, male. Contents: 1 vial of ≥1x10^6 viable cryopreserved cells. Edit: GCaMP8m. Marker Expression: Spinal Motor Neurons (BX-0100) have high neuronal purity (>80%) and consist of greater than 70% motor neurons. Labeling with the pan-neuronal marker MAP2 (green) and the motor neuron-specific marker FOXP1 (red) highlights the purity of this neuronal product. Function: Spinal Motor Neurons exhibit pronounced electrophysiological activity after two weeks in culture, as demonstrated by multi-electrode array (MEA) recordings. Related diseases: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S), Spinal muscular atrophy (SMA), & Spinal Cord Injury. Primary neurotransmitter released: Acetylcholine
